Output 13d27669d350877e6aa595b8fd556e1ea15cb7d37369eac983137aae2c977592:1

value
635000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ba95aef780506e5eaeaaf0f1e2feab53f84ef49b OP_EQUAL
address
3JhavQwgTVr9BdhScKVNCpKdQonPYg1ffT
transaction
13d27669d350877e6aa595b8fd556e1ea15cb7d37369eac983137aae2c977592
confirmations
466871
spent
true